Bill 250,706 would change zoning at 5751 North Broad Street from CMX‑2.5 to CMX‑3 to facilitate an urgent care facility. The Planning Commission witness said staff will recommend approval and the Committee on Rules reported the bill with a favorable recommendation and suspended rules for first reading.

The Committee on Rules voted to report Bill 250,706 with a favorable recommendation and to suspend the rules to permit first reading, advancing a zoning change that would allow an urgent care facility at 5751 North Broad Street.
